This describes the Z-Wave device MSP-3-1-X1, manufactured by ID-RF with the thing type UID of nodon_msp31x1_00_000
.
The MSP-3-1-X1 supports routing. This allows the device to communicate using other routing enabled devices as intermediate routers. This device is also able to participate in the routing of data between other devices in the mesh network.

The following table provides a summary of the 10 configuration parameters available in the MSP-3-1-X1. Detailed information on each parameter can be found in the sections below.
Param | Name | Description |
---|---|---|
1 | Default State | Status after a power outage or after being plugged |
3 | Follow State | Allows to enable or disable Group 2 & Group 3 |
4 | Always On | Forces the Micro Smart Plug status to be ON |
21 | Power Auto-Sending Report | Power report for changes of x % W |
22 | Overload Report | Switch off Micro Smart Plug in case the power is above x W |
23 | Energy Auto-Sending Report | Auto energy report if value changes of x Wh |
24 | Metering Heartbeat | Reporting intervall for power and energy to lifeline. |
25 | Power High Threshold | Defines the High Threshold value in W. |
26 | Power Low Threshold | Defines the Low Threshold value in W. |
27 | Power Threshold Action | Defines actions if the power Low/High Threshold are reached. |
Switch All Mode | Set the mode for the switch when receiving SWITCH ALL commands |
Status after a power outage or after being plugged This parameter defines the status of the Micro Smart Plug after a power outage or after being plugged The following option values may be configured -:
Value | Description |
---|---|
0 | Off |
1 | On |
2 | Status before power outage |
The manufacturer defined default value is 2
(Status before power outage).
This parameter has the configuration ID config_1_1
and is of type INTEGER
.
Allows to enable or disable Group 2 & Group 3 This parameter allows to enable or disable Group 2 & Group 3
The value may be the sum of available values. For example, if you want to enable Group 2 & 3, the parameter value is 1+2=3 The following option values may be configured -:
Value | Description |
---|---|
0 | Group 2 & Group 3 disable |
1 | Group 2 enable |
2 | Group 3 enable |
3 | Group 2 & Group 3 enable |
The manufacturer defined default value is 3
(Group 2 & Group 3 enable).
This parameter has the configuration ID config_3_1
and is of type INTEGER
.
Forces the Micro Smart Plug status to be ON This parameter forces the Micro Smart Plug status to be ON. While enable it is not possible to switch OFF the plug (local or wireless). The following option values may be configured -:
Value | Description |
---|---|
0 | Always ON disable |
1 | Always ON enable |
The manufacturer defined default value is 0
(Always ON disable).
This parameter has the configuration ID config_4_1
and is of type INTEGER
.

Switch off Micro Smart Plug in case the power is above x W This parameter will switch off the Micro Smart Plug in case the power is above x W (Watt) and send an alarm to the primary controller. This parameter has the highest execution priority between all the metering configurations for security reason. The following option values may be configured, in addition to values in the range 0 to 2000 -:
Value | Description |
---|---|
0 | Overload Report Disable (Not Recommended) |
50 | Overload Report enable with a upper limit of 50 W |
100 | Overload Report enable with a upper limit of 100 W |
150 | Overload Report enable with a upper limit of 150 W |
200 | Overload Report enable with a upper limit of 200 W |
250 | Overload Report enable with a upper limit of 250 W |
500 | Overload Report enable with a upper limit of 500 W |
1000 | Overload Report enable with a upper limit of 1000 W |
1500 | Overload Report enable with a upper limit of 1500 W |
2000 | Overload Report enable with a upper limit of 2000 W |
The manufacturer defined default value is 2000
(Overload Report enable with a upper limit of 2000 W).
This parameter has the configuration ID config_22_2
and is of type INTEGER
.

Defines actions if the power Low/High Threshold are reached. This parameter will define the Micro Smart Plug actions if the power Low and High Threshold are reached.
The value may be the sum of available values. For example, if you want:
- Power High Threshold Action is enable and sent ON to Group 4 (3)
- Power Low Threshold Action is enable and sent OFF to Group 5 (4)
the parameter value must be 3+4=7. The following option values may be configured -:
Value | Description |
---|---|
0 | Power Threshold Action is disable. |
1 | Power High Group 4 OFF |
3 | Power High Group 4 ON |
4 | Power Low Group 5 OFF |
5 | Power High Group 4 OFF & Power Low Group 5 OFF |
7 | Power High Group 4 ON & Power Low Group 5 OFF |
12 | Power High Group 5 ON |
13 | Power High Group 4 OFF & Power Low Gourp 5 ON |
15 | Power High Group 4 ON & Power Low Group 5 ON |
The manufacturer defined default value is 7
(Power High Group 4 ON & Power Low Group 5 OFF).
This parameter has the configuration ID config_27_1
and is of type INTEGER
.

Association groups allow the device to send unsolicited reports to the controller, or other devices in the network. Using association groups can allow you to eliminate polling, providing instant feedback of a device state change without unnecessary network traffic.
The MSP-3-1-X1 supports 6 association groups.
Report Information to Main Controller. This group is generally used to report information of the Micro Smart Plug to the Main Controller of the network.
Association group 1 supports 5 nodes.
Send status if local button is used to associated devices. When the Micro Smart Plug is switched ON (respectively OFF) using the local button, it will send ON (respectively OFF) command to the associated devices. No command is sent if the Micro Smart Plug is switched ON or OFF wirelessly.
This group is configurable through the parameter 3.
Association group 2 supports 5 nodes.
Send status if local button is used to associated devices. When the Micro Smart Plug is switched ON (respectively OFF) using the local button, it will send OFF (respectively ON) command to the associated devices. No command is sent if the Micro Smart Plug is switched ON or OFF wirelessly.
This group is configurable through the parameter 3.
Association group 3 supports 5 nodes.
Send ON/OFF command to associated devices if threshold reached When the Micro Smart Plug reaches over the high threshold of power defined by the configuration parameter, it will send OFF or ON command to the associated devices.
This group is configurable through the parameter 25 and 27.
Association group 4 supports 5 nodes.
Send ON/OFF command to associated devices if threshold reached When the Micro Smart Plug reaches below the low threshold of power defined by the configuration parameter, it will send OFF or ON command to the associated devices.
This group is configurable through the parameters 26 and 27.
Association group 5 supports 5 nodes.
Report metering to devices in this group. All the meter reports and notifications triggered by Metering parameters will be reported to the devices present in this group.
This group is configurable through the parameters 21, 22, 23 and 24.
Association group 6 supports 5 nodes.
